Emmanuel Tarpin
Emmanuel Tarpin is a French contemporary jewelry designer. Since 2018, he founded his self-titled atelier for high-end jewelry. He lives in Paris.
Biography
Emmanuel Tarpin was born in 1992 in Annecy, Haute-Savoie, France. In childhood he practiced sculpture. Tarpin is openly queer.He graduated from the Geneva University of Art and Design in 2014. After graduation he worked on the jewelry bench at Van Cleef & Arpels, and remained there for three years. In 2018, he founded his own atelier for high-end jewelry. In 2019, he made a capsule collection for Swiss luxury jeweler De Grisogono.
In 2019, he won the Town & Country Jewelry Award for "Breakthrough Designer of the Year". Celebrities that have worn his work include Mandy Moore, and Rihanna. Prices for Tarpin’s jewelry in 2019 started around 15,000 euros.
